1On June 10, 2009, the Tribunal issued an Interim Decision, 2009 HRTO 821, which ordered that the Application be deferred pending the conclusion of a grievance proceeding.
2On April 11, 2012, the applicant filed a Request for an Order During Proceedings which requested that the Tribunal issue an order to reactivate his deferred Application. In his submissions, the applicant stated that his Union informed him that the respondent plans to give him his job back, but he has no further details of the settlement and is not aware when the grievance process concluded.
3On April 25, 2012, the respondent filed a Response which opposed the applicant’s Request to reactivate his Application because the grievance proceeding is ongoing. In its submissions, the respondent stated that the respondent and the Union had entered into a proposed settlement of the applicant’s grievance, which had a condition that he must withdraw his human rights Application, but, to date, he has not agreed to the proposed settlement.
4Rules 14.3 and 14.4 of the Tribunal’s Rules of Procedure provide:
14.3 Where a party wishes the Tribunal to proceed with an Application which has been deferred the request must be made in accordance with Rule 19.
14.4 Where an Application was deferred pending the outcome of another legal proceeding, a request to proceed under Rule 14.3 must be filed no later than 60 days after the conclusion of the other proceeding, must set out the date the other legal proceeding concluded and include a copy of the decision or order in the other proceeding, if any.
5The applicant’s Request to reactivate his Application is denied because the grievance proceeding has not concluded.
